Printing
%KEYWORD%% is a process for production of texts and images, typically with ink on paper through a Printing press. It is often carried out as a large-scale industrial process, and is an essential part of publishing and transaction Printing. Printing was first conceived and developed in China. Primitive woodblock Printing was already in use by the 6th century in China. The oldest known Korean surviving printed document is a Buddhist scripture, which dates to back 751 AD. The oldest surviving book printed using the more sophisticated block Printing, dates back to 868 AD. The development of the Printing press revolutionized communication and book production, which lead to the spread of knowledge. Books and newspapers are printed today using the technique of offset lithography. Other common techniques include flexography, relief print, screen Printing, inkjet, hot wax dye transfer, and laser Printing.
